Synopsis:
Anne Boleyn(Henny Porten) is coveted by King Henry VIII (Emil Jannings) when he tires of Queen Katherine. The ruler desires an heir to the throne, and Katherine has not provided one. Henry goes against the wishes of the pope, divorces Katherine, and forms the Church of England. Sir Henry Norris (Paul Hartmann) is her jealous boyfriend who leaves when he suspects Anne and the King of having an affair. A spectacular crowd scene is the marriage of Anne and Henry at the Cathedral and the sumptuous festivities that followed. Henry's attentions turn to Lady Seymour after Anne bears the child that would be Queen Elizabeth. Boleyn is tortured and confesses to infidelity before being sentenced to death by the pompous monarch.
